Understanding the Omicron Variant: What We Know So Far
As the world continues to grapple with the COVID-19 pandemic, a new variant, Omicron, has emerged, causing concerns and raising questions about its impact on public health. Here’s what we know so far about the Omicron variant:
- Omicron was first detected in South Africa in November 2021.
- The variant has a large number of mutations, particularly in the spike protein, which is concerning as it could potentially impact transmissibility and immune evasion.
- Preliminary evidence suggests that Omicron may be more transmissible than previous variants, but more research is needed to confirm this.
Scientists and public health experts are closely monitoring the spread of the Omicron variant and conducting studies to better understand its characteristics and potential impact. Potential Impact of Omicron on Global Health and Economy
The emergence of the Omicron variant has raised concerns about its potential impact on global health and the economy. As the variant continues to spread rapidly across the world, there are several key areas that could be affected:
- Healthcare Systems: The influx of Omicron cases could strain healthcare systems, leading to potential shortages of hospital beds, medical supplies, and healthcare workers.
- Travel and Tourism: The uncertainty surrounding the variant may result in renewed travel restrictions and reduced tourism, impacting businesses and employment in the travel industry.
- Supply Chains: Disruptions in supply chains due to lockdowns or restrictions could lead to shortages of essential goods and inflationary pressure on prices.
Overall, the potential impact of Omicron on global health and the economy is still uncertain, and it will be critical for governments, businesses, and individuals to continue monitoring the situation closely and taking appropriate measures to mitigate the risks.
Recommendations for Mitigating the Spread of Omicron
It is crucial to take proactive measures to mitigate the spread of the Omicron variant. Here are some recommendations to help keep yourself and others safe:
- Get vaccinated: Ensure you are fully vaccinated against COVID-19, including receiving booster shots if eligible.
- Follow public health guidelines: Adhere to local health authority recommendations regarding mask-wearing, social distancing, and other safety protocols.
- Practice good hygiene: Wash your hands frequently with soap and water, and use hand sanitizer when handwashing is not possible.
Additionally, consider reducing non-essential activities and gatherings, especially in high-risk areas. By taking these precautions, we can collectively work towards slowing the spread of the Omicron variant and protecting our communities.
